State Financed Health Insurance Plan Other Than Medicaid - Drug and Alcohol Rehabilitation Facilities - Wendell, ID.

There are programs available in some states for residents to get treatment for a drug or alcohol addiction with resources offered by state financed health insurance, other than Medicaid. State financed health insurance plans that pay for addiction recovery often provide these services in state run facilities, and the people most often targeted to get this type of coverage through state health insurance are individuals who are homeless, living under the poverty level in that state, have income that meets the requirement to be covered by the state plan, and for those who don't have Medicaid or some other health coverage. In most cases, drug and alcohol treatment paid for by state financed health insurance plans other than Medicaid is completely free of charge.

State financed health insurance plans, other than Medicaid, which cover addiction rehabilitation usually offer a limited scope of services but may offer services that cover detox and emergency intervention services to help the individual get clean and sober as fast and as safe as possible. This may consist of a safe and stable inpatient or residential treatment facility, with options to then move into sober living facilities or similar programs which can offer housing and other necessities until the individual can get back on their feet and find a way to live and work outside of treatment and sober living.

The services provided by each state providing health insurance plans other than Medicaid may vary and there may be limited availability in some facilities, but residents in Wendell can contact an administrative office for state financed health plans to determine if they are eligible and what is required to get enrolled in a rehab center right away.
